Output d9324ce66af7bdc2ef81d3cfaa5eeb54954b45b759a1a1ce938d4e76acb25cdb:0

value
1496513040
script pubkey
OP_0 OP_PUSHBYTES_20 5f60e24a11a483da40785314edd7aea9fdc63b66
address
bc1qtaswyjs35jpa5src2v2wm4aw487uvwmxdra87h
transaction
d9324ce66af7bdc2ef81d3cfaa5eeb54954b45b759a1a1ce938d4e76acb25cdb
spent
true